Definitions
- the present invention relates to a container consisting of an outer and an inner container as disclosed in the preamble of claim 1.
- a pliable sack e.g., a plastic sack filled with a liquid, would not be stable, but instead is shapeless and would therefore have to be either placed on a pallet/shelf with casings or suspended in a specific apparatus designed there ⁇ for.
- This form of packaging is therefore difficult to handle, and for this reason it is desirable to produce a container that is stable and thereby easier to manipulate. This is, not least, because a pliable material such as plastic, for example, is preferable for the transporting of liquids, particularly because such a container could- be packed up after being emptied and before being filled, and would occupy a minimum of space.
- the inner sack filled with a fluid would, in a suitable manner, fill up the outer sack, which would now form a stable container that stands firmly on a base.
- the container's stability will increase with the number of curves in the spiral form of the inner sack.
- Figure 1 is a schematic illustration of an embodiment of the invention .
- Figure 2 is a schematic illustration of a further embodiment of the invention.
- FIG. 1 On Figure 1 is shown an outer container 1 with a tubular inner container 5 coiled up in the form of a spiral and closed at one end 3 thereof, and having a filling opening at 4.
- the inner container may have the form of an ascending spiral.
- the closed end is positioned at the bottom of outer container 1.
- the filling tube or end piece 4 of inner container 5 may contain a closing mechanism or other known per se filling mechanisms.
- the outer container 1 may also be completely closed at both ends thereof, with the filling mechanism of the inner container projecting out through an opening in outer container 1.
- tubular any elongate, hollow body having a round, rectangular or other cross-sectional form.
- Figure 2 shows an additional embodiment form where the filling opening 4 to the inner container 5 is fed through the spiral and passed out at the bottom of outer container 1.
- the other end 3 of the inner container may be closed, or it may be fed out of inner container 1 together with filling opening 4, and both ends, then, may be open or may be provided with closing mechanisms that can be closed as desired.
- the discharge opening may be in the form of a top end piece or a valve provided at the bottom or at the top of the outer sack.
- the outer container 1 may consist of a material such as, e.g., woven propylene, and would determine the form and volume of the container.
- the inner container 5 may consist of polyethylene foil and may be formed as a tube that is closed at one end 3 and coiled like a spiral or formed as a spiral, with an outlet 4 at the opening of outer container 1.
- the inner container may also consist of a tube that is open at both ends and which is fed out at the opening or the bottom of outer container 1 , as men ⁇ tioned above.
- the inner container filled with a liquid would in a suitable manner fill out the outer container 1, which would now form a stable container that stands firmly on a base.
- the stability of the container will increase with the number of curves in the spiral of the inner container.
- the dimensions of the tube are determined on the basis of the desired number of curves in the spiral that will be positioned in the outer container and suitably filled to a desired level.
- the inner container 5, as mentioned above, may consist of a tube, or may be produced in the form of a spiral, with dimensions that are appropriate for the liquid with which it is to be filled, with respect to viscosity, stability and the form and volume of the outer container.
- the inner container 5 may consist of a plurality of helical inner containers that are closed at one end, with an outer container 1.
- the inner containers may also be corrugated and closed at one end thereof.
